This week on the Flipped Learning Network Show:

Our guest is Stacey Roshan, a dedicated AP Calculus and Honors Algebra teacher whose primary goal is to relieve the stress that high level math produces in students. As a nurturing facilitator, Stacey explains how her students excel with the flipped model. Stacey has been chosen as NAIS Teacher of the Future for her innovation at the Bullis Upper School in Potomac, Maryland.
